Aziziye Hamamı, Kadıköy'de bir hamam
Aziziye Hamamı is a traditional Turkish bathhouse located in the Kadıköy district. The building features high ceilings, warm-colored walls, and marble surfaces arranged in separate rooms designed for different stages of the bathing experience.
The bathhouse was established over a century ago and has served the community as a place for washing and relaxation since then. Its long history shows how this institution remained a part of the city through different periods and was used by generations of residents.
The name Aziziye refers to a Turkish term. In the bathhouse, the separation of spaces for men and women shows how locals have traditionally gathered here to wash and spend quiet time together.
The bathhouse is open most days during daytime hours and fits easily into a visit to Kadıköy. It is helpful to wear loose, light clothing and be prepared that towels and soap are usually provided by staff, though local advice can help you fully enjoy the experience.
Many longtime residents visited this bathhouse as children and still remember their time there. These personal connections show how the bath remained a gathering place for the local community across generations.
